Titans End Regular Season With Loss To Blugolds

The UW-Oshkosh women's tennis team concluded the regular-season portion of its 2020-21 schedule with a 9-0 Wisconsin Intercollegiate Athletic Conference loss to UW-Eau Claire on Wednesday (April 21) in Eau Claire.

UW-Oshkosh suffered defeat in two hard-fought singles battles, including Maddie Toboyek's 7-5, 6-4 loss to Lindsey Henderson in the second flight. Titan Michelle Spicer lost her No. 1 singles contest by a 6-2, 6-4 result to Elaina Franta.

UW-Eau Claire's four remaining individual victories featured 6-1, 6-0 wins by Alexa Brooks over Hannah Stitt in the fourth flight, Morgan Nelson over Madeline Beck in the fifth and Sydney Presler over Angie Carini in the sixth. Blugold Emily Cooper won her No. 3 singles contest with a 6-1, 6-1 decision over Courtney Salisbury.

UW-Oshkosh's best result during the doubles competition occurred in the first flight, where Spicer and Toboyek lost an 8-3 verdict to Franta and Henderson.

The No. 2 doubles scuffle had UW-Eau Claire's Brooks and Cooper defeat Carini and Salisbury, 8-2.

UW-Eau Claire won all eight games at No. 3 doubles as Nelson and Natalie Girard ousted Beck and Stitt.

UW-Oshkosh (0-7, 0-6 WIAC) and UW-Eau Claire (9-4, 5-1) will exchange serves again on Saturday (April 24) when the two programs meet in Whitewater during the first round of the WIAC Championship.
